Mastering Game Selection and RTP Analysis
The foundation of any successful online gambling strategy lies in informed game selection. This goes far beyond simply choosing games you enjoy. Experienced players meticulously analyze Return to Player (RTP) percentages, volatility, and house edge. RTP represents the theoretical percentage of wagers a game will pay back to players over time. Higher RTP generally translates to a better long-term expectation. However, it’s crucial to understand that RTP is a theoretical figure, and short-term results can vary significantly. Volatility, or variance, measures the risk associated with a game. High-volatility games offer the potential for larger payouts but also carry a greater risk of losing streaks. Low-volatility games provide more frequent, smaller wins.
Beyond RTP, consider the game’s features and paytable. Bonus rounds, free spins, and special symbols can significantly impact your overall return. Analyze the paytable to understand the value of each symbol and the potential payouts for different combinations. For table games, the house edge varies depending on the specific rules. Blackjack, for instance, offers a relatively low house edge when played with optimal strategy. Baccarat also has a low house edge, while roulette can be less favorable due to the presence of the zero or double-zero. Always research the specific rules of a game before playing, as variations can significantly impact your odds.
Strategic Bankroll Management
Effective bankroll management is the cornerstone of responsible and profitable online gambling. It’s not just about having a large bankroll; it’s about managing your funds strategically to weather losing streaks and maximize your chances of long-term success. The first step is to establish a dedicated bankroll specifically for online gambling. This should be separate from your everyday finances and should be an amount you can afford to lose without financial hardship.
Once you have a bankroll, determine your betting limits. A common strategy is to risk a small percentage of your bankroll on each bet, typically 1-3%. This helps to protect your bankroll from significant losses during unfavorable periods. Adjust your betting limits based on the volatility of the game. For high-volatility games, you might consider a lower percentage, while for low-volatility games, you could potentially increase your bet size slightly. Regularly review your bankroll and adjust your betting limits accordingly. If your bankroll increases, you can increase your bet sizes proportionally. If your bankroll decreases, you should reduce your bet sizes to protect your remaining funds.
Exploiting Bonus Offers and Promotions
Online casinos frequently offer bonuses and promotions to attract and retain players. However, not all bonuses are created equal. Experienced players understand how to evaluate bonus offers and identify those that offer the best value. Pay close attention to the terms and conditions, including wagering requirements, game restrictions, and time limits. Wagering requirements specify the amount you must wager before you can withdraw any winnings from the bonus. Higher wagering requirements make it more difficult to profit from a bonus.
Game restrictions limit the games you can play with the bonus funds. Some games contribute less towards the wagering requirements than others. For example, slots often contribute 100%, while table games may contribute significantly less. Time limits specify how long you have to meet the wagering requirements. If you don’t meet the requirements within the specified time, the bonus and any associated winnings will be forfeited. Look for bonuses with reasonable wagering requirements, minimal game restrictions, and ample time limits. Consider the expected value of the bonus, taking into account the RTP of the games you plan to play and the wagering requirements. Finally, always read the fine print and understand the terms and conditions before claiming a bonus.
